When a tire fails before a
crash and thereby causes a
crash - and is determined to have done so
due to a design, manufacturing, or warnings defect, the tire manufacturer and others in the chain
of the tire's production and distribution may be held strictly liable for consequent damages suffered by injured
victims or deceased
victims» survivors.
